Community helping Kaiapoi North School pupils get to Santa Parade after fire

Nicole Mathewson Reporter from Northern Outlook

The Kaiapoi community has rallied to ensure pupils at a school hit by a "heartbreaking" fire can still take part in their town's Santa Parade.

The Kaiapoi community has rallied to ensure pupils at a school hit by a "heartbreaking" fire can still take part in their town's Santa Parade.

The Kaiapoi Promotions Association has offered to create a float for the school and has received support from Kaiapoi Menz Shed, Kaiapoi Monograms, the Woodend Lions and other local businesses.

The Kaiapoi-Tuahiwi Community Board has also approved a $500 grant to pay for building materials.

North Canterbury is set to host its first National Rose Show this weekend

The New Zealand Rose Society has been holding national shows for more than 50 years, but this year marks the first time it will be held in this region.

Show conveners Michael and Marion Brown, from Loburn, said this year's show, with the theme of Rose Magic, will be held at the Woodend Community Centre on November 23 to 25.

"There will be something for everyone; it will be an event that smells lovely and looks lovely," the organisers say.

Canterbury cattle breeders named local heroes

A North Canterbury couple have been acknowledged for their work teaching high school students how to handle animals safely.

Kay and Philip Worthington, who own Woolstone Park Lowline cattle stud near Rangiora, are recipients of this year's Kiwibank New Zealand Local Hero Medal.

"The best feeling [is] seeing these kids go and do something with the the skills they have learnt," Kay says.
